Waste-to-Resource

Waste-to-Resource (WTR) refers to processes that transform waste materials into useful products or energy, minimizing environmental impact. Instead of discarding waste, technologies like recycling, composting, or waste-to-energy plants convert it into things like electricity, fuel, or raw materials for manufacturing. This approach reduces landfill use, conserves natural resources, and promotes sustainability. Essentially, WTR turns what would be trash into valuable resources, helping to create a cleaner environment and a more circular economy where waste is reused rather than wasted.
